NourishNourish

Personalized nutrition counseling with RDs, covered by insurance

Strengths

  • +High percentage of patients pay $0 out of pocket due to insurance coverage.
  • +Available in all 50 states, increasing accessibility to nutrition care.
  • +Demonstrates significant clinical outcomes in weight loss, A1C, cholesterol, and blood pressure reduction.
  • +Provides a holistic approach to health, considering various lifestyle factors beyond just diet.
  • +Offers continuous support through a dedicated dietitian and mobile app features.

Weaknesses

  • -Requires insurance coverage for most patients to be affordable.
  • -Effectiveness relies on patient engagement with the program and dietitian.
  • -Specific dietitian availability may vary based on location and specialization needs.

Key features

Telehealth appointments with Registered DietitiansInsurance coverage for servicesPersonalized nutrition assessment and care plansOngoing coaching and recommendationsMobile app for communication and goal trackingCurated content including recipes and condition guides
Starts at Custom

Lin HealthLin Health

Reclaim your life from chronic pain with evidence-based, brain-first treatment.

Strengths

  • +Clinically validated intervention with high reported patient improvement (92%)
  • +Significant reduction in pain intensity (45%)
  • +Addresses chronic primary pain as defined by ICD-11
  • +Covered by most major insurance plans, increasing accessibility
  • +Reduces patient wait times and provider burnout

Weaknesses

  • -Requires active patient engagement (2-3 days weekly)
  • -Success depends on belief in the brain-first approach
  • -Requires commitment to a journey of improvement, not a quick fix

Key features

Nervous system signaling techniques for pain reductionMultidisciplinary clinical guidanceHigh-frequency coachingEvidence-based digital resourcesProprietary technology for patient outcomesIn-network with most major insurance plans (including Medicare)
Starts at $159/mo
